<h2 id="steps-to-set-up-your-shopify-store" tabindex="-1" class="sb">Steps to Set Up Your Shopify Store</h2>
<p>Want to launch your CPG brand on Shopify? Let&#8217;s walk through the key steps to build a store that turns browsers into buyers.</p>
<h3 id="pick-the-right-shopify-plan" tabindex="-1">Pick the Right Shopify Plan</h3>
<p>Your choice of Shopify plan affects both your costs and what you can do with your store. Here&#8217;s a simple breakdown of the plans:</p>
<table style="width:100%;">
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Plan</th>
<th>Monthly Cost</th>
<th>Best For</th>
<th>Key Features</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>Basic</td>
<td>$29</td>
<td>New CPG brands</td>
<td>2 staff accounts, basic reports</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Shopify</td>
<td>$79</td>
<td>Growing brands</td>
<td>5 staff accounts, professional reports</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Advanced</td>
<td>$299</td>
<td>Established CPG brands</td>
<td>Custom reporting, third-party shipping rates</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
<p>Here&#8217;s what you might not know: The Advanced plan can actually save money for high-volume CPG brands. With just 0.5% transaction fees and tools like custom reporting and third-party shipping rates, it often pays for itself.</p>
<h3 id="create-a-storefront-that-drives-sales" tabindex="-1">Create a Storefront That Drives Sales</h3>
<p>Your store needs to show off your CPG products in the best light possible. If you&#8217;re just starting out, Shopify&#8217;s templates make this process much easier. Here&#8217;s what works:</p>
<p><strong>Make it pop visually</strong>: Use crisp, clear photos of your packaging and show your products being used in real life. And here&#8217;s something crucial: Over 60% of your visitors will browse on their phones, so your store needs to look great on small screens.</p>
<p><strong>Put product details front and center</strong>: Don&#8217;t make customers hunt for information. Display ingredients, nutrition facts, and allergen details where they&#8217;re easy to spot. Think of it like a well-organized product label &#8211; everything important should be quick to find.</p>
<h3 id="add-tools-and-apps-for-operations" tabindex="-1">Add Tools and Apps for Operations</h3>
<p>The right tools can make running your store much smoother. Here&#8217;s what you need:</p>
<p><strong>Run like clockwork</strong>: Tools like Stocky and ShipStation take the headache out of tracking inventory and handling shipments. They work alongside Shopify&#8217;s built-in features to keep everything running smoothly.</p>
<p><strong>Know your customers</strong>: Apps like <a href="https://www.luckyorange.com/" target="_blank"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" style="display: inline;">Lucky Orange</a> or <a href="https://www.hotjar.com/" target="_blank"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" style="display: inline;">Hotjar</a> show you exactly how people use your store. It&#8217;s like having a window into your customers&#8217; minds &#8211; you can see where they get stuck and fix those spots to boost sales.</p>

<h2 id="how-to-grow-your-cpg-brand-on-shopify" tabindex="-1" class="sb">How to Grow Your CPG Brand on Shopify</h2>
<h3 id="improve-listings-and-pricing" tabindex="-1">Improve Listings and Pricing</h3>
<p>Want to boost your sales? Start with your product pages. Here&#8217;s why: 76% of shoppers make their buying choices based on package design and product information. Make sure your listings include high-quality images that show your products from multiple angles and highlight packaging details.</p>
<p>Product bundles are a smart way to boost sales. Take Heyday Canning&#8217;s success story &#8211; they launched a &#8216;Pantry Starter Kit&#8217; bundle that became their #1 selling product in just two months, pushing their average order value up by 35%.</p>
<h3 id="keep-customers-coming-back" tabindex="-1">Keep Customers Coming Back</h3>
<p>Here&#8217;s a secret weapon for CPG brands: subscriptions. With Shopify&#8217;s built-in subscription tools, you can set up flexible delivery schedules that keep customers ordering month after month. Let&#8217;s break down the numbers:</p>
<ul>
<li>Auto-replenish subscriptions for everyday items: customers stick around 8-12 months</li>
<li>Discovery boxes: 4-6 months of customer loyalty</li>
<li>Build-a-box options: impressive 10-14 month retention</li>
</ul>
<p>Smart product recommendations based on purchase history can work wonders. Look at <a href="https://www.drinktrade.com/pages/subscribe?srsltid=AfmBOoq98Z79rrjRUSFfT7YgFjitOX4TRMLtXsS8uBdL4z1w2EOL4Oi1" target="_blank"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" style="display: inline;">Trade Coffee</a> &#8211; they maintain a strong 60% subscription retention rate by suggesting products their customers actually want. For example, if you run a skincare brand, you might suggest moisturizers to people who buy cleansers.</p>
<h3 id="analyze-data-to-grow" tabindex="-1">Analyze Data to Grow</h3>
<p>Keep your eyes on these numbers:</p>
<table style="width:100%;">
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Metric</th>
<th>Target Range</th>
<th>What to Do</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>Customer Lifetime Value</td>
<td>&gt;3x CAC</td>
<td>Fine-tune your retention tactics</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Repeat Purchase Rate</td>
<td>&gt;25%</td>
<td>Make post-purchase better</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Average Order Value</td>
<td>15% yearly growth</td>
<td>Test different bundles</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
<p>Watch which products sell best across your channels. If you notice organic traffic dropping, it might be time to update your SEO or try new marketing approaches.</p>

<h2 id="1.-personalization-at-scale" tabindex="-1" class="sb">1. Personalization at Scale</h2>
<p>Here&#8217;s an eye-opening stat: Personalized emails bring in 6x more transactions than generic ones. That&#8217;s why CPG brands need to go way beyond just slapping a customer&#8217;s name on an email in 2025.</p>
<p>Smart brands dig into their customer data &#8211; what people buy, what they browse, when they shop &#8211; to create emails that actually speak to different customer groups. Let&#8217;s break down how personalization works in today&#8217;s CPG world:</p>
<table style="width:100%;">
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Personalization Type</th>
<th>Engagement Boost</th>
<th>How Hard Is It?</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>Basic (Name + Location)</td>
<td>20% boost</td>
<td>Easy</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Behavioral (Purchase History)</td>
<td>45% boost</td>
<td>Medium</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>AI-Powered</td>
<td>75% boost</td>
<td>Tricky</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
<p>AI tools are changing the game by automatically creating and fine-tuning content. They tap into customer data to:</p>
<ul>
<li>Pick products customers will actually want based on what they usually buy</li>
<li>Send emails when customers are most likely to open them</li>
<li>Remind customers to restock before they run out</li>
</ul>
<p><strong>Here&#8217;s how it works in real life:</strong> Take a beauty brand that uses AI to track customer habits. The system spots that Sarah always buys sunscreen in early spring. Bang! She gets a perfectly-timed email about sun protection and beach must-haves right when she&#8217;s thinking about summer.</p>
<p>Or think about Tom, who&#8217;s big on skincare. The system keeps track of his routine and sends him emails about products that go well with what he already uses, plus tips and gentle nudges when he might be running low.</p>
<p>This smart approach helps brands see the full picture of what their customers want and need, leading to emails that people actually want to open &#8211; and products they want to buy.</p>
<h2 id="2.-adding-interactive-features-to-emails" tabindex="-1" class="sb">2. Adding Interactive Features to Emails</h2>
<p>Let&#8217;s face it: static emails just don&#8217;t cut it anymore for CPG brands in 2025. Here&#8217;s why: interactive emails get 73% more clicks than their static counterparts.</p>
<p>Want to know what works? Product polls boost engagement by 45%, embedded videos drive 65% more interaction, and dynamic product catalogs increase engagement by 70%. But it&#8217;s not just about throwing in random interactive elements &#8211; you need to pick features that make sense for your products.</p>
<p>Take beauty brands, for example. They use quizzes to match customers with the perfect products. Food brands? They let customers play around with recipe builders to see their ingredients in action.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s a real success story: A major snack brand added a recipe builder to their emails. Customers could mix and match products to create their own snack combinations. The results? <strong>60% more engagement</strong> and a jump in sales through direct purchase options in the emails.</p>
<p>CPG brands are making their emails work harder with features like:</p>
<ul>
<li>Product demos and size guides that show customers exactly what they&#8217;re getting</li>
<li>Rating systems where customers share feedback right in their inbox</li>
<li>Live inventory updates that create buying urgency for hot items</li>
</ul>
<p>The best part? Customers don&#8217;t need to click away to another page. They can explore, learn, and buy &#8211; all without leaving their email.</p>
<p>But here&#8217;s the thing: these interactive emails need to play nice with your other marketing channels. They&#8217;re just one piece of the puzzle in creating a smooth customer experience.</p>

<h2 id="6.-highlighting-transparency-in-messaging" tabindex="-1" class="sb">6. Highlighting Transparency in Messaging</h2>
<p>Here&#8217;s something that might surprise you: 85% of consumers actively look for transparent brands. Even better? 75% will pay extra for products from brands they trust.</p>
<p>Let&#8217;s look at Patagonia&#8217;s playbook. They&#8217;ve turned their supply chain story into engaging email content with maps you can click through and eye-catching visuals. The result? Their emails get 43% more engagement than regular promotional ones.</p>
<p>Want to know what&#8217;s working for top CPG brands in 2025? Check this out:</p>
<table style="width:100%;">
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Transparency Element</th>
<th>Impact on Engagement</th>
<th>Best Practice Example</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>Ingredient Sourcing</td>
<td>+32% open rates</td>
<td>Seventh Generation&#8217;s farm-to-bottle tracking</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Environmental Impact</td>
<td>+28% click-through</td>
<td>Patagonia&#8217;s carbon footprint emails</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Manufacturing Process</td>
<td>+25% response rate</td>
<td>Method&#8217;s factory tour series</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
<p>Take Seventh Generation&#8217;s &quot;Clean Ingredients&quot; emails. They break down what&#8217;s in their products and why it matters. Simple stuff, but it works &#8211; they&#8217;ve seen 47% more customers stick around after subscribing to these emails.</p>
<blockquote>
<p>&quot;Transparency is no longer a choice; it&#8217;s a requirement for brands that want to build trust with consumers.&quot; &#8211; Todd Morris, CEO of Label Insight</p>
</blockquote>
<p>The trick isn&#8217;t dumping technical info on your customers. Smart brands tell stories with pictures and keep things simple. When you&#8217;re explaining where your products come from, use clear icons and short explanations that make sense.</p>
<p>Modern shoppers want to know what you stand for. They&#8217;re interested in:</p>
<ul>
<li>How you treat your workers</li>
<li>What you&#8217;re doing for the environment</li>
<li>Whether your claims check out</li>
</ul>
<p>The numbers speak for themselves: brands that put transparency first see 94% higher loyalty rates. It&#8217;s not just about being open &#8211; it&#8217;s about building real connections that last.</p>
<p><strong>Pro tip</strong>: Back up your claims with solid proof and certifications in your emails. Your customers will thank you for it.</p>
